Hyper Recruitment Solutions are looking to speak with enthusiastic and driven Scientific Graduates who are interested in working in the field of Regulatory Affairs. This is an entry level position within a Regulatory Consultancy based in commutable distance from North London where extensive training will be offered!

As the Regulatory Affairs Assistant you will support the Regulatory Affairs team on a range of projects and activities. You will learn and develop knowledge across a number of areas and will become involved in supporting a variety of activities to broaden your experience.

KEY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

Your duties as the Regulatory Affairs Assistant will be varied however the key duties and responsibilities are as follows:

1. Compile Regulatory Submissions in eCTD or NeeS format.

2. Draft, compile & submit a variety of Regulatory documents including artwork updates and post-approval variations.

What you will gain from this opportunity:

1. An in-depth understanding of Regulatory legislation and an overview of Regulatory activities undertaken by Regulatory Affairs Professions.

2. An exciting platform from which to develop your Regulatory Affairs career

ROLE REQUIREMENTS:

To be successful in your application to this exciting opportunity as the Regulatory Affairs Assistant we are looking to identify the following on your profile and past history:

1. Relevant degree in a Life Sciences discipline (e.g. Biology, Pharmacology, Pharmacy, Chemistry etc.)

2. An interest in working within Regulatory Affairs is important for this position and a general understanding of the function of Regulatory Affairs within the Pharmaceutical industry.

3. Ability to work under pressure and achieve timely submission and regulatory approvals
